An Act relative to student absences based on religiously held beliefs, the official text

	SECTION 1. Chapter 71 of the General Laws, as appearing in the 2022 Official Edition, is hereby amended by inserting at the end the following:-   
	Section __: Notwithstanding section 31A, no student shall be punished for an absence when such absence is the result of the observance of a meaningfully held religious belief.    
	SECTION 2. This act shall take effect upon its passage.
